Understanding 401(okay) and Gold IRA



A 401(okay) plan is a retirement savings vehicle offered by employers, permitting workers to save lots of a portion of their paycheck before taxes are taken out. Contributions to a 401(k) are often matched by the employer up to a certain proportion, offering an incentive for employees to save for retirement.


On the other hand, a Gold IRA is a kind of self-directed IRA that allows investors to hold physical gold or other valuable metals as a part of their retirement portfolio. This type of investment is taken into account a hedge in opposition to inflation and economic downturns, as gold has historically maintained its value over time.


The Rollover Course of



1. Eligibility



Earlier than initiating a rollover, it is essential to determine eligibility. Usually, individuals can roll over their 401(ok) into a Gold IRA if they have left their job, are retiring, or if their current employer’s plan allows for in-service distributions.


2. Choosing a Custodian



To establish a Gold IRA, investors should choose a custodian who focuses on treasured metals. The IRS mandates that IRAs be held by an permitted custodian, and never all custodians handle gold investments. It is crucial to conduct thorough research to seek out a reputable custodian with a stable track report and transparent payment constructions.


3. Opening a Gold IRA



After selecting a custodian, the following step is to open a Gold IRA account. This process usually involves filling out an software, offering needed identification, and agreeing to the custodian's terms and conditions.


4. Initiating the Rollover



As soon as the Gold IRA account is established, the individual can initiate the rollover process. This often entails contacting the 401(k) plan administrator to request a direct rollover. A direct rollover is preferred because it transfers funds straight from the 401(okay) to the Gold IRA, avoiding any tax penalties.


5. Purchasing Gold



After the funds are efficiently transferred, the investor can instruct the custodian to purchase gold or different permitted valuable metals. The IRS has particular laws regarding the forms of gold that may be held in an IRA, including gold bullion and certain gold coins that meet purity requirements.


Benefits of Rollover 401(k) into Gold IRA



  1. Diversification: Incorporating gold into a retirement portfolio can provide a hedge towards market volatility and inflation, diversifying the investment technique.


  2. Safety In opposition to Economic Uncertainty: Gold has historically been viewed as a protected-haven asset. Throughout occasions of economic instability, gold often retains or will increase its worth, making it a horny option for retirement savings.


  3. Tax Benefits: Like traditional IRAs, Gold IRAs provide tax-deferred growth. Which means traders don't pay taxes on good points until they withdraw funds throughout retirement.


  4. Physical Asset Ownership: Investing in gold permits people to personal a tangible asset, which might present a way of safety and control over their retirement financial savings.


Dangers and Concerns



  1. Market Fluctuations: Whereas gold is often considered a secure investment, its value will be volatile. Traders should remember of the potential for loss if the market declines.


  2. Storage and Insurance coverage Fees: Bodily gold requires secure storage, which may incur extra costs. Buyers should consider these charges when contemplating a Gold IRA.


  3. Restricted Investment Choices: A Gold IRA restricts the forms of investments that can be held inside the account. Buyers may miss out on different lucrative alternatives accessible in traditional IRAs.


  4. Custodian Charges: Gold IRAs usually come with larger fees compared to conventional IRAs as a result of complexities of handling bodily belongings. It is important to grasp the payment structure before proceeding.
